Start rapidly, so regarding lessen the possibilities of mold and mildew creating. Keep in mind, mold and mildew shows up within 24 hours of water damages as well as the spores easily spread out to components of your home not impacted by water damages. Flooring fans, dehumidifiers, ac unit, as well as wet/dry vacs are all your buddies during this process and also all aid to avoid mold on carpeting after water damages.


Get rid of any kind of drenched items from the home, such as items of furniture. This stops them leaking onto components, floor covering, and also near walls.


If the water damage is near the breaker box, appliances, or electric outlets, call in an experienced pro to guarantee safety. The very same goes for significant water damages, no matter the place.

Among the most extreme concerns that can take place is the weakening of your house's architectural stability. When the timber in your house absorbs water, it can rot and possibly collapse. Unattended water damage can also ruin your electrical systems, wear away plumbing, ruin your ceilings and also wall surfaces, and create mold and mildew development.


Even if mold dries out does not suggest it passes away or is gone with good. Once it's dry, mold will come to be dormant for a while until it is once again subjected to a new wetness source or moisture. Once that takes place, it will reactivate and expand and be at greater risk of ending up being air-borne.




Simply due to the fact that the water dries out does not indicate you must overlook it. If you do not attend to water damages immediately, it can bring about mold and mildew development as well as various other troubles with your house. In severe situations, water damages can compromise your home's or structure's architectural integrity, so it's finest to tackle it head-on.

Water damage, whether it be timber rot, rusting, mold and mildew or bacterial growth, etc, is just one of the most typical (and also most irritating) source of homeowners insurance coverage cases.


Homeowners insurance coverage will certainly likewise cover any water damage arising from tornados such as rain, cyclones, twisters, and much more. As an example, severe climate causes a tree to fall on your residence, insurance policy will certainly likewise cover any water damage, such as mold or wood rot, arising from the occurrence. Damages created from rain simply seeping into your house or flooding your cellar is not covered, however we'll obtain into that more listed below.

If the following water damage circumstances take place to you, they will not be covered under your homeowners insurance coverage. As we already pointed out, house owners insurance policy commonly only covers water damage that is unexpected as well as accidental, so gradual water damage, or water damages resulting from bad maintenance usually isn't covered.
